On May 29
th 2009, people gathered to watch the awarding of three Klocko scholarships to students of Arundel High School, South River High
School, and Southern High School.
Marsha Perry was the
key note speaker. She explained how John Klocko had been an exceptional leader. She also recounted many humorous anecdotes.
Doctor Karen Klocko presented the scholarships to three young women.
Mary Rosekrans of Arundel High School was the first to receive an scholarship. She will be going to
Towson University to study Criminal Justice.
Erika Yost of South River High School will be
going to The School of Visual Arts in New York City to major in Advertising Design.
Kara
Barnhart of Southern High School will be attending Loyola University of Maryland.
